Honor Pad X7 Launched With 8.7-Inch Display, Snapdragon 680, and 7,020mAh Battery

Honor has officially introduced its latest budget-friendly tablet, the Honor Pad X7, expanding its portfolio with a device focused on delivering strong performance and all-day battery life. Unveiled in Saudi Arabia on July 25, 2025, the Pad X7 targets students, professionals, and families seeking a feature-rich tablet at an accessible price point.

Specs and Features

The Honor Pad X7 stands out with its sleek metal body and an immersive 8.7-inch TFT LCD display boasting a smooth 90Hz refresh rate. Under the hood, the tablet runs on the Qualcomm Snapdragon 680 octa-core processor paired with up to 6GB RAM and 128GB internal storage, expandable to 1TB via microSD. It comes loaded with Android 15 and houses a powerful 7,020mAh battery supporting both 10W wired and reverse charging. For eye comfort, the display is TUV Rheinland certified for low blue light and flicker-free viewing. Other features include an 8MP rear camera, a 5MP front camera, dual-band Wi-Fi, Bluetooth 5.0, and a slim, lightweight design at just 365g and 7.99mm thickness.

Pricing and Availability

The Honor Pad X7 is available in Saudi Arabia at a price of SAR 449 (approximately ₹10,300 or USD119) for the 4GB/128GB model. Interested buyers can purchase the tablet in grey from authorized Honor retailers and online outlets, with a wider global launch expected soon.
